1995 Ford Explorer vs. 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500

To start off, 1995 Ford Explorer is newer by 5 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500 would be higher. At 4,973 cc (8 cylinders), 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500 (326 HP @ 5700 RPM) has 116 more horse power than 1995 Ford Explorer. (210 HP @ 5250 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500 should accelerate faster than 1995 Ford Explorer.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1995 Ford Explorer weights approximately 180 kg more than 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500.

Let's talk about torque, 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500 (480 Nm @ 3900 RPM) has 148 more torque (in Nm) than 1995 Ford Explorer. (332 Nm @ 3250 RPM). This means 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1995 Ford Explorer.

Compare all specifications:

1995 Ford Explorer 1990 Mercedes-Benz 500
Make Ford Mercedes-Benz
Model Explorer 500
Year Released 1995 1990
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 3996 cc 4973 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type V V
Horse Power 210 HP 326 HP
Engine RPM 5250 RPM 5700 RPM
Torque 332 Nm 480 Nm
Torque RPM 3250 RPM 3900 RPM
Number of Seats 4 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 5 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 1910 kg 1730 kg
Vehicle Length 4790 mm 4750 mm
Vehicle Width 1880 mm 1890 mm
Vehicle Height 1840 mm 1430 mm
Wheelbase Size 2840 mm 2810 mm
